We stand on the threshold of a new era in artificial intelligence that promises to achieve an unprecedented level of ability. A new generation of agents will acquire superhuman capabilities by learning predominantly from experience. This note explores the key characteristics that will define this upcoming era.

AI is transitioning from an era dominated by human data to one driven by experiential learning. While current AI systems like large language models have achieved impressive capabilities by training on human-generated data, they're approaching the limits of what can be learned from existing human knowledge. The authors propose that the next breakthrough will come from agents that learn continuously through direct interaction with their environments, generating their own data that improves as they become stronger. This new paradigm will feature agents that operate in continuous streams rather than discrete episodes, with actions and observations grounded in real-world environments, rewards derived from measurable outcomes rather than human judgments, and reasoning processes that aren't limited to human modes of thinking. The authors cite AlphaProof's medal-winning performance in the International Mathematical Olympiad as evidence this transition has already begun, and suggest experiential learning will ultimately enable superhuman capabilities across many domains by allowing AI to discover knowledge beyond current human understanding.
